**Ticket GLX-214: Gallery audio stalls after track 3**

App: Murmura audio guide, plugin SDK v2.1.

Repro:
1. Load the Hollowfen Museum tour pack.
2. Play tracks 1–3.
3. Track 4 hangs at 0:00.

Only occurs when plugin prefetch is enabled. To hit the staging prefetch API yourself, authenticate with the bearer token below.

session JWT of yawep-yawep = eyJhbGciOiJIUzI1NiIsInR5cCI6IkpXVCJ9.eyJzdWIiOiI3pWF3_In0.aXYsHiog

Breakdown attached: 60% headcount, 25% infrastructure, 15% contingency. No discretionary spend included. Hollis has vetted the figures against the revised forecast.

Decision needed by Friday's board call. Happy to walk through line items on request.

The confidential rationale tied to our expansion plans follows below.

— D. Ostrander, CFO

internal memo for kawip-hadug: Headcount on the Wenwyn team goes from 7 to 140 by the end of January. Gross margin on Wenwyn came in at 20 percent against a plan of 15 percent.

Handover Note — Loyalty Overhaul

Hi all — as I hand the Brightloop programme over to Director Ansel Varick, a quick recap for the sales leads. The points-to-tiers migration is 80% done; Meridale pilot stores report higher repeat visits, though redemption costs ran hot in month two. Ansel will own vendor talks with Quillword Systems from Monday. Keep nudging enrolments at till — it's working. Questions go to Ansel going forward, not me. One more thing before I sign off, and keep it close.

board note of kadup-kagag: Headcount on the Holwyn team goes from 9 to 80 by the end of October. Gross margin on Holwyn came in at 10 percent against a plan of 10 percent.

## Build Provenance: Session-Token Refresh Fix

Welcome aboard. The refresh bug in Lanternworks' auth service caused sessions to expire mid-request; the fix shipped in the hardened build described here. Before deploying anywhere, confirm the artifact came from our attested pipeline — contractors must never use locally built binaries. Verify your artifact against the provenance token below.

build token for kagaf-hahof: htk14_9d3d4d26d7d8de